The Story of Porkies

A Restaurant in Silvis, IL

In 1987, a group of local business leaders, led by Lee Womack, were at a party and started talking about the great Charbroiled Butterfly Pork Chop sandwiches served at the former Hardees Golf Classic (now the John Deere Classic). They decided someone should start a restaurant that served those same Charbroiled Butterfly Pork Chops. Before that night was over, they decided to do it themselves. At the time, the group became aware that the former Mr. Quick restaurant building in Silvis, IL was empty. It was located at the corner of Hero Street and First Avenue in Silvis, the perfect place for the new venture. They contacted the owner of the property and negotiated a purchase. After spending over $120,000 in improvements, the doors opened in November, 1987, with the name of Porkies.

In 2001, Lee Womack died and Mark Petersen, a local area CPA who had previously served as Corporate Secretary-Treasurer since inception, assumed the reins as CEO. As the restaurant evolved, so did the ownership to the point that now the ownership is only Petersen and store manager Roger Pulford. Pulford has been in store management since the store opened and has been an owner since 2006.

Fast forward to February 13, 2017. Roger Pulford, part owner and store manager, was opening up as always, shortly after 5:00 AM. He had just turned on the exhaust fans when the ansul fire suppression system kicked on. He immediately saw the fire in the exhaust fan over the fryers. Luckily, due to the quick response from the Silvis Fire and Police Departments, the building was saved, though there was extensive smoke damage. After over $200,000 of building renovations and equipment replacements, the doors were re-opened to the public on May 12, 2017.
